Abstract

Gluing agent prescription that EPDM rubber is bonded with polyester line and preparation method thereof is improved the invention discloses a kind of, adhesive Formulation Ingredients mainly include:EPDM elastomeric compounds, phenolic resin, isocyanates, gasoline.EPDM elastomeric compounds are formed by ethylene propylene diene rubber 4045, DCP, sulphur, altax, accelerator TT, zinc oxide ZnO, stearic acid StA, carbon black, white carbon, paraffin oil, anti-aging agent RD mixing.It is 100 by EPDM elastomeric compounds, phenolic resin, isocyanates and gasoline weight ratio:5‑10:0‑3:1000 are made adhesive, can effectively improve the bonding strength of EPDM rubber and polyester line, environmental pollution is small, and preparation technology is simple, practical.

Background technology
EPDM rubber is by the non-polar rubber of ethene, propylene and a small amount of non-conjugated diene hydrocarbon copolymerization.Because of its master Chain is made up of chemically stable saturated hydrocarbons, only contains unsaturated double-bond in side chain, therefore its resistance to ozone, heat-resisting, weather-proof etc. are resistance to Ageing properties are excellent, can be widely used for the fields such as auto parts and components, electric wire and cable jacket, sebific duct, adhesive tape.But EPDM rubber point Nonpolarity substituent in sub, intermolecular cohesive energy is low, causes the tack and mutual viscosity of EPDM rubber poor, with other skeletons Bonding force is also very poor.At present, people are made corresponding metal salt, are then added in rubber by acrylic acid modified, in vulcanization In play a part of metal adhesion promoters, this auxiliary agent can realize the direct bonding of EPDM rubber and metal, but bonding Effect is poor.There is document report to add RS/A adhesives in EPDM rubber, select suitable vulcanizing system, EPDM can be solved With vinylon line adhesion problem, but the bonding for polyester line not yet has been reported that.
The content of the invention
The invention aims to the adhesion problem for solving EPDM rubber and polyester line, there is provided one kind raising EPDM rubbers Gluing agent prescription that glue is bonded with polyester line and preparation method thereof, by adding phenolic resin, isocyanates in adhesive, Coordinate appropriate vulcanizing system, improve the bonding force of EPDM rubber and polyester line.
It is a kind of to improve gluing agent prescription that EPDM rubber is bonded with polyester line and preparation method thereof, adhesive Formulation Ingredients bag Include following parts by weight component:
EPDM elastomeric compounds:100;
Phenolic resin:3-10;
Isocyanates:0-5;
Gasoline:1000.
Described EPDM elastomeric compounds are formed by the mixing of following percentage by weight raw material:
Ethylene propylene diene rubber 4045:100;
Vulcanizing agent DCP:0.5-4.0;
Sulphur:0.5-2.0;
Altax:0.6-1.8;
Accelerator TT:0.5-2.0;
Zinc oxide ZnO:5-10;
Stearic acid StA:1.0-2.5;
Carbon black:40-80;
White carbon:10-20;
Paraffin oil:5-20;
Anti-aging agent RD:1.0-2.0.
Described phenolic resin is resorcinol-formaldehyde resin;Described vulcanizing agent DCP is cumyl peroxide;Institute The altax stated is two thio benzothiazoles;Described accelerator TT is two thio tetra methylthiurams;Described age resistor RD is 4- trimethyl -1,2- dihyaroquinolines;Described carbon black be N330, N550, spray carbon black, N990, N774 any one Or several compositions.
It is a kind of to improve gluing agent prescription that EPDM rubber is bonded with polyester line and preparation method thereof, including EPDM elastomeric compound systems Preparation Method and adhesive preparation method, be specially:
EPDM elastomeric compound preparation methods, comprise the following steps:
Step one:The auxiliary agent and vulcanizing agent in ethylene propylene diene rubber 4045, formula, the auxiliary agent are weighed by ratio of weight and the number of copies For zinc oxide ZnO, stearic acid StA, carbon black, white carbon, paraffin oil, anti-aging agent RD;The vulcanizing agent is DCP, sulphur, accelerator DM, accelerator TT, auxiliary agent and vulcanizing agent are well mixed respectively.
Step 2:Ethylene propylene diene rubber is plasticated in banbury, then added well mixed auxiliary agent in banbury Banburying, finally adds back mixing after vulcanizing agent thin logical 6-12 times on a mill.
Adhesive preparation method, comprises the following steps:
EPDM elastomeric compounds are dissolved in gasoline and stir 24-48h, phenolic resin and isocyanates stirring 6-12h are added extremely Uniform state.
Embodiment
With reference to embodiment, the present invention is described in further detail, but this should not be interpreted as to the present invention The scope of above-mentioned theme is only limitted to following embodiments.
Embodiment 1:
4,045 100 parts of ethylene propylene diene rubber is first weighed by ratio of weight and the number of copies;Auxiliary agent:5 parts of zinc oxide ZnO, stearic acid StA 1 part, 60 parts of carbon black, 10 parts of white carbon, 5 parts of paraffin oil, 1 part of anti-aging agent RD;Vulcanizing agent:2 parts of DCP, 0.5 part of sulphur, promotion 0.6 part of agent DM, 1.5 parts of accelerator TT;Auxiliary agent and vulcanizing agent are well mixed respectively.Then by ethylene propylene diene rubber in banburying Plasticated in machine, well mixed auxiliary agent is then added into banburying in banbury, back mixing after vulcanizing agent is finally added on a mill It is thin logical 6-12 times.
EPDM elastomeric compound 200g are taken, 2000g gasoline stirring and dissolving 24h are added, phenolic resin 10g are added, stirring 6h is extremely Uniformly.
Embodiment 2:
4,045 100 parts of ethylene propylene diene rubber is first weighed by ratio of weight and the number of copies;Auxiliary agent:5 parts of zinc oxide ZnO, stearic acid StA 1 part, 60 parts of carbon black, 10 parts of white carbon, 5 parts of paraffin oil, 1 part of anti-aging agent RD;Vulcanizing agent:2 parts of DCP, 0.5 part of sulphur, promotion 0.6 part of agent DM, 1.5 parts of accelerator TT;Auxiliary agent and vulcanizing agent are well mixed respectively.Then by ethylene propylene diene rubber in banburying Plasticated in machine, well mixed auxiliary agent is then added into banburying in banbury, back mixing after vulcanizing agent is finally added on a mill It is thin logical 6-12 times.
EPDM elastomeric compound 200g are taken, 2000g gasoline stirring and dissolving 24h is added, adds phenolic resin 10g, isocyanates 1g, 6h is to uniform for stirring.
Embodiment 3:
4,045 100 parts of ethylene propylene diene rubber is first weighed by ratio of weight and the number of copies;Auxiliary agent:10 parts of zinc oxide ZnO, stearic acid 1 part of StA, 60 parts of carbon black, 20 parts of white carbon, 5 parts of paraffin oil, 1 part of anti-aging agent RD;Vulcanizing agent:4 parts of DCP, 0.5 part of sulphur, 0.6 part of altax, 1.5 parts of accelerator TT;Auxiliary agent and vulcanizing agent are well mixed respectively.Then ethylene propylene diene rubber is existed Plasticated in banbury, well mixed auxiliary agent is then added into banburying in banbury, finally added on a mill after vulcanizing agent Back mixing is thin logical 6-12 times.
EPDM elastomeric compound 200g are taken, 2000g gasoline stirring and dissolving 24h is added, adds phenolic resin 10g, isocyanates 1g, 6h is to uniform for stirring.
Embodiment 4:
4,045 100 parts of ethylene propylene diene rubber is first weighed by ratio of weight and the number of copies;Auxiliary agent:5 parts of zinc oxide ZnO, stearic acid StA 1 part, 60 parts of carbon black, 10 parts of white carbon, 5 parts of paraffin oil, 1 part of anti-aging agent RD;Vulcanizing agent:2 parts of DCP, 0.5 part of sulphur, promotion 0.6 part of agent DM, 1.5 parts of accelerator TT;Auxiliary agent and vulcanizing agent are well mixed respectively.Then by ethylene propylene diene rubber in banburying Plasticated in machine, well mixed auxiliary agent is then added into banburying in banbury, back mixing after vulcanizing agent is finally added on a mill It is thin logical 6-12 times.
EPDM elastomeric compound 200g are taken, 2000g gasoline stirring and dissolving 24h is added, adds phenolic resin 10g, isocyanates 6g, 6h is to uniform for stirring.
